A cold is one of those things we all catch at some point. It’s not usually serious, but it can be pretty annoying. While there’s no “magic cure” to get rid of it overnight, there are a few things you can do to feel better and recover faster. Here are some tips on how to cure a cold and make it as painless as possible.

1. Get plenty of rest

First things first, get some rest. Even if you don’t want to stay in bed all day, your body needs to slow down to fight off the virus. Don’t try to keep up with your normal routine if you’re feeling lousy. The more rest you get, the quicker you’ll recover.

2. Stay hydrated

Drinking water is key when you have a cold. You can also go for broths, herbal teas, or natural juices. Staying hydrated helps your body flush out the virus faster. Avoid caffeine and, of course, skip the alcohol.

3. Take medications to relieve symptoms

There’s no magic pill that will cure a cold, but you can take some medications to ease the symptoms. For fever and aches, acetaminophen or ibuprofen can help. You can also use decongestants or cough syrup. Just remember to check with a doctor before self-medicating.

4. Try home remedies

If you’re into natural solutions, there are home remedies that can help a lot. Here are a few to try:

  • Honey and lemon: Great for soothing a sore throat.
  • Steam inhalation: Heat up some water, cover your head with a towel, and breathe in the steam to clear your nose.
  • Ginger and garlic: Brewed into a tea, they can help relieve symptoms and boost your immune system.

5. Eat well, but don’t overdo it

You don’t have to eat like there’s no tomorrow, but it’s important to maintain a balanced diet. Soups, fruits, and veggies will help you feel better. Avoid heavy foods that might upset your stomach. If you don’t have much of an appetite, that’s fine; just eat what you can.
